Tate Conjecture And Finiteness of Abelian Varieties over Finite Field

Anningzhe Gao

Open full text 0 citations

Abstract

In this paper we will prove that Tate conjecture of abelian varieties over finite field is equivalent to the finiteness of isomorphism classes of abelian varieties with a fixed dimension. We give a different approach with Zarhin's result.
